FEATURED MAG OF THE MONTH: STRANGER:

We have a great range of creative and cool magazines stocked here at kitch-en but many of you may not know what these magazines are all about. That's why we've decided to do a little feature on a magazine each month and show you what's what. This month we're throwing the spotlight onto a cool little A5-er known as STRANGER.

So What is it?
From their website: "Stranger is an award-winning creative lifestyle, surf, music, environment and graphics magazine based in Falmouth, Cornwall. We hope to offer a fresh and inspiring vision of life, different from anything you've seen in other publications".
What's in it?
Over 90 pages of well designed articles covering life, earth & sounds. The latest issue (no.12) contains features such as:
• 'Men in Black' - a look at the bouncers that keep us safe in clubs around the country, or do they?
• 'Let's Talk About Sex' - A chat with independent film maker Ed Blum who's just released his debut film 'Scenes of a Sexual Nature'
• 'Hot Air' - A look at the political debate over climate change.
It also includes interviews with up and coming bands, news, cool new fashion as well as the 'Stranger Folio' - a look at emerging artists and designers.
How much is it?
The vital piece of information... it's just £1.50 so for that price you can't go wrong. Even if you're not totally into the 'surf culture' it's still a very entertaining and graphically interesting read.

CURRENT & UPCOMING EXHIBITIONS:

MY NY at Arc, Stockton - New York Photography by Mark Warner
Now showing at The Ground Floor, Arc, Dovecot Street, Stockton-on-Tees, TS18 1LL until 31st December

A trip to New York in 2004 inspired Mark to produce a series of prints and an accompanying photo book that explore the hidden elements of the city.

“Having experienced all the typical tourist attractions, which were pleasant, I found myself wandering the back streets; being inspired by all the obscure, small details, the fragments that really make New York the amazing place that it is. It was all of these details that really made a lasting impression on me and created my memories of New York”

DECAY - Paintings on steel & canvas by Ged Holmes
Showing at The Ground Floor, Arc, Dovecot Street, Stockton-on-Tees, TS18 1LL from 1st - 31st January.

So not to influence the audience's perception and view of his work, Ged does not give an insight into his inspiration and thought process other than the title. He wants the viewer to be intrigued and puzzled by each piece, and as a result, persuades their own imagination to reflect on his work.

Geds exhibition at The Arc in January is titled Decay and consists of steel sheets with acrylic and large stretched canvas with acrylic and stitched cotton, hung throughout the ground floor.

FULL ON FUTURES WORKSHOP SUCCESS & WINNING MAGAZINE:

Creative Partnerships Tees Valley once again hosted the Full on Futures event at Darlington F.C. during Enterprise Week to highlight the links between creativity and entrepreneurship and to support young people's understanding of the creative sector. The event was aimed at 14-16 year olds to give them the opportunity to meet with engaging, enterprising people, to help raise aspirations and to see real life examples of creative businesses.
One such business was us chaps at kitch-en, we held full day workshops across the 4 days engaging with various schools from across the Tees Valley teaching them 'How to Make a Magazine'. The workshop consisted of giving an insight into everything it takes to make a magazine, from assigning job roles, to working out how to appeal to a specific audience, formulating content - both written and visual, designing the layout, considering how to generate money from a magazine to actually creating a finished mock-up which was presented at the end of each day.
Each magazine produced was entered into a competition to win the opportunity to have the magazine published with a limited print run by kitch-en. At the end of the week the winning magazine was decided upon by kitch-en and the Creative Partnerships team as: "The Locker", produced by a group from Hummersknott School in Darlington.

KENAZ ISSUE 6 OUT NOW:

KENAZ is well established now in the Tees Valley as a FREE independent zine dedicated to showcasing top quality new writing accompanied by some great art, illustration and design all produced by folk from across the Tees Valley region.
Now in it's sixth instalment, KENAZ is flying off the shelves of independent coffee shops, bars, restaurants & shops as well libraries and other public information points around the Tees Valley. It is published 3 times a year by Bob Beagrie & Andy Willoughby from Ek Zuban press in Middlesbrough with art direction handled by us here at kitch-en.
If you want a copy you better be quick, there are only 3,000 copies ever printed and word on the street suggests they won't be around for long.
